  1. I have a Philips HTS3544 Home Theatre System. It's a great unit for the price. My only complaint is that it seems to have trouble playing +R DL discs without freezing. This happens consistently. Moreover, I'm noticing that the freezing seems to happen after the second half of the DVD -- possibly after the layer break? There's nothing wrong with the DVD backup itself because it'll play in my standalone Magnavox unit just fine. I'm using Verbatim DVD+R DL's, so I doubt it's the media.

    Does anyone have this unit and what's been your experience with it?

    How far into the movie does it do this? Is in the last half of the second half?

    You might still want to encode short of the full dual layer capacity. It might be the same symptom some single layer discs have of having bad edges. If you don't encode the full disc and it still happens then perhaps its something else?

  3. Since I've been paying attention, I think it's happening during the second half. That's what led me to theorize that it had something to do with the layer break. But, if I take that disc and play it on my Magnavox DVD player, the disc plays flawlessly. I highly suspect that my Philips unit is either faulty or just hypersensitive to read errors.

    I think I know what you're getting at by suggesting to encode short of the full DL capacity. I can say that I can't honestly remember if any of my SL backups experienced the same freezing symptoms. I'll have to verify that. It doesn't look like Philips is coming out with any more firmware revisions to fix the problem (if that's the problem, of course).
